【中小学】上下册初二八年级上下程序设计语言与流程图基础2教学设计公开课教案教学设计课件.docxVIP

【中小学】上下册初二八年级上下程序设计语言与流程图基础2教学设计公开课教案教学设计课件.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《程序设计语言与流程图基础 (第 2 课时)》教学设计 xxxxxxxxxx中心 xx图 【教学内容分析】 本节内容为xxxxx研究院编出版的《信息技术》(2020 年 8 月印刷本) 初中第二册 第 2 章《程序设计初步》第 1 节《程序设计语言与流程图基础》,该节计划 2 课时,这是第 2 课时。本节内容是后续章节的学习基础与必须用的工具。 本节课他们学习程序设计的一般过程,体验 fChart 流程图编辑、执行程序的过程,学 会使用Blockly 积木建立程序,同时了解 Python 语言,学会用 Python 运行代码。 教学重点:程序设计的一般过程。 教学难点:三种工具 (fChart、Blockly、Python Shell) 的使用。 【教学对象分析】 本课的教学对象为初二年级学生,在学习本课前已经或多或少接触过程序设计,部分学 生有使用 scratch 搭积木制作程序的经验,对于程序设计存在有好奇心但也有一定的畏难情 绪。通过上一节课的学习,他们了解了程序与程序设计语言的知识,认识了算法的和流程图, 掌握了流程图的常用符号及其代表的功能。 【教学目标】 学生了解程序设计的一般步骤。 学生体验流程图辅助工具 fChart 的编辑、执行程序的过程。 学生学会使用代码生成工具:Blockly。 学生初步认识 Python,并学会用 Python Shell 运行 Python 代码。 学生能仿照示例自主建立程序。 【教学策略】 内容安排上,按照程序设计中解决问题的一般过程,从问题分析-代码设计-编写-运行 的递进顺序,采用“讲-演-练”的模式来安排教学活动: 教师通过复习上节课所学引出新课,通过示例讲述程序设计的一般步骤,并且通过视频 进行巩固并学习本节课所涉及的 3 种工具。通过课堂练习,让学生掌握 Python 中 print 命 令的使用方法。再通过课堂练习,让学生掌握结合 fChart、Blockly 和 Python shell 的编 程方法。 课堂教学环节:复习导入-新知探究-课堂练习-小结归纳。 【教学媒体选择】 多媒体网络机房,多媒体课室控制管理广播系统,课室投影系统。 【教学过程】 xx 教师活动 学生活动 设计意图 新课引入 1、 自我介绍。 2、 复习提示:上节课学习内容。 3、 展示本节课的学习主题。 通过上节课所学知识的相 关性,引起学生对本节课的 兴趣。 直接导入主题 学习目标 介绍本节课学习内容和目标。 明确学习内容与目标。 明确课堂目标 xx探究 1、通过课件讲解程序设计的一般步 骤。 2、以让计算机输出:Hello World! 为情景讲解程序设计的一般步骤。 3、播放视频:用 fChart 建立第一 个程序,学习 fChart、Blockly 和 Python Shell 的使用。 4、总结视频内容,并导入 print 命令xx。 5、通过课件讲解 print 命令的格 式、功能、表达式类型等知识。 6、进入练习 1,巩固学生对 print 命令表达式类型的掌握。 7、进入练习 2,让学生在计算机实 操复杂的 print 命令 ,从而导入 print 命令的扩展格式xx。 8、最后进行练习 3,实操完成建立 一个程序,整体巩固整节课的知识。 听讲、思考、理解、实践。 重点知识讲解 与学习 知识巩固 引导学生思考练习题,并分析正确 答案。 (1) “编写程序代码”是程序设计 的一般步骤中的第几步? ( ) A.第一步 B.第二步 C.第三步 D.第四步 答案:C (2) 工具 fChart 的功能是 ( ) A.问题分析,确定计算机需要完成 的功能。 B.设计流程图,明确计算逻辑。 C.积木编程,并生成 Python 代码。 D.运行 Python 代码。 答案:B (3)下面哪一个 print 命令书写是 正确的 ( ) A.print(“abecd”“sdd”) B.print(asdas) C.print(80+100) D.print(“123”abc) 答案:C 学生做题、思考、巩固知识。 本节课知识xxx。 课后作业 课后作业布置 1、 知识回顾 2、 知识梳理 重点巩固 课堂小结 1、 回顾程序设计的一般步骤与对 1、知识回顾 知识梳理 应的工具:流程图设计 fChart, 积木编程 Blockly,代码生成与 调试 Python Shell; 2、 重点知识:print 命令语法。 2、知识梳理 【教学评价设计】 形成性评价:能正确打开三种工具,运行示例程序。 终结性评价:能正确完成课堂任务,程序运行正确。

文档评论(0)

风的故乡 清 + 关注
实名认证
文档贡献者

风的故事

1亿VIP精品文档

相关文档